Standard Output Shaft Suffix Codes — All 310 Variants
| Bonfiglioli Suffix | Output Shaft Type | Mounting | Available in Our 310 Series |
|---|---|---|---|
| NHC / HC | Heavy-duty flanged output — keyed shaft | Flange | ✓ Yes |
| NHZ / HZ | Heavy-duty splined male shaft | Flange | ✓ Yes |
| NPC / PC | Foot base — keyed shaft | Foot | ✓ Yes |
| FZ / FZB | Hollow splined shaft | Flange | ✓ Yes |
| FP | Hollow shaft for shrink disc | Flange | ✓ Yes |
310 Series in Context — Bonfiglioli 300 Series Frame Size Ladder: The 310 is frame size 17 of 20 in the Bonfiglioli 300 Series (309 → 310 → 311). The adjacent sizes — 309 (T2max ~25,000 N·m) and 311 (T2max ~55,000 N·m) — are available from our range as the 309 Series and 311 Series, respectively. Always confirm the exact frame size number from the nameplate before ordering; 309, 310, and 311 housings are dimensionally distinct and cannot be interchanged. 310 Series Inline Planetary Gearbox — Technical Specifications
Standard engineering parameters for the 310 Series, aligned with the Bonfiglioli 310 and equivalent OEM specifications. All parameters match or exceed the original OEM ratings.
| Parameter | Specification | Notes |
|---|---|---|
| T2max (Peak Torque) | ~40,000 N·m (354,000 in·lbs) | Matches Bonfiglioli 310 T2max specification |
| Transmissible Power | Up to 540 kW | Matches Bonfiglioli 300 Series power ceiling |
| Gear Ratio Range | 3.4:1 – 9,000:1 | 1 to 4 inline stages; right-angle 2–4 stages |
| Gear Unit Versions | Inline (L) / Right-angle (R) with spiral bevel first stage | Matching Bonfiglioli 310L and 310R configurations |
| Output Configurations | Flanged keyed shaft / Splined shaft / Foot keyed / Hollow splined / Hollow with shrink disc | All Bonfiglioli 310 suffix codes reproduced |
| Input Configurations | Flanged axial-piston motor / Orbit motor / IEC B5 / NEMA / Solid input shaft | Custom adaptor plates for non-standard motors |
| Brake Options | Hydraulic-released parking brake / DC electric brake / AC electric brake | Rated to hold full nominal output torque at any ratio |
| Transmission Efficiency | 96% – 98% per stage | Rolling-contact planetary; consistent with OEM spec |
| Gear Material | 20CrMnTi / 18CrNiMo7-6 Alloy Steel | Carburised, 58–62 HRC; profile-ground DIN/ISO Class 6 |
| Housing Material | Ductile Iron GGG-50 | Machined to Bonfiglioli 310 reference dimensions |
| Sealing / IP Rating | IP65 standard / IP67 optional | Double-lip shaft seals; cassette seals for harsh duty |
| Lubrication | Mineral or Synthetic ISO VG 220/320 gear oil | Vent, level, and drain plug positions match OEM |
| Operating Temperature | -30°C to +100°C | Extended range options for arctic and tropical environments |
| Surface Treatment | Epoxy primer + two-component PU topcoat | Salt spray >500 hours per ISO 9227 |
| Design Life (B10) | 3,000+ hours at rated load | Per ISO 281 bearing life and AGMA 2001 gear durability |
| Certification | ISO 9001:2015, CE Declaration of Conformity | Factory acceptance test report supplied with every unit |
| Lead Time | 7 – 20 days (standard) / 30 – 60 days (custom ratio) | Common 310L2 / 310L3 replacement ratios in partial-build stock |

How the 310 Series Inline Planetary Gearbox Works
The 310 Series uses the same coaxial multi-stage planetary gear architecture as the Bonfiglioli 310 it replaces. Five steps describe the complete power flow:
Motor Input
The electric or hydraulic motor drives the first-stage sun gear at rated input speed. The input flange matches the motor standard exactly — IEC, SAE, or NEMA — eliminating adaptor plates in direct replacement installations.
Planet Gear Load Sharing
Three or more planet gears mesh simultaneously with the sun gear and the fixed ring gear (annulus). Each planet carries a proportional share of total torque — enabling the compact 310 housing to transmit ~40,000 N·m peak torque reliably across the full range of gear ratios.
First-Stage Reduction
The planet carrier outputs at reduced speed and amplified torque. Speed drops and torque increases in direct proportion to the first-stage ratio. The coaxial arrangement maintains input-output alignment — the defining feature of an inline planetary gearbox.
Additional Stages
For high ratios — 100:1 to 9,000:1 — the 310 Series adds up to three additional reduction stages. Each stage multiplies output torque while adding only modest axial length, keeping the unit within the same footprint as the original Bonfiglioli 310.
Coaxial Output
The final-stage carrier drives the output shaft or flange — fully coaxial with the motor input — through exactly the same output interface geometry as the Bonfiglioli 310 it replaces, enabling a direct bolt-in installation with no modification to the driven equipment.
